文摘Re-Os radiometric dating of crude oil can be used to constrain the timing of hydrocarbon generation,migration or charge.This approach has been successfully applied to marine petroleum systems;however,this study reports on its application to lacustrine-sourced natural crude oils.Oil s amples from multiple wells producing from the Cretaceous Nantun Formation in the Wuerxun-Beier depression of the Hailar Basin in NE China were analysed.Subsets of the Re-Os data are compatible with a Cretaceous hydrocarbon generation event(131.1±8.4 Ma)occurring within 10 Myr of deposition of the Nantun Formation source rocks.In addition,two younger age trends of 54±12 Ma and 1.28±0.69 Ma can be regressed from the Re-Os data,which may reflect the timing of subsequent hydrocarbon generation events.The Re-Os geochronometer,when combined with complementary age dating techniques,can provide direct temporal constraints on the evolution of petroleum system in a terrestrial basin.
